Ransomware attacks are becoming alarmingly frequent and sophisticated, posing severe risks to state and local government by compromising data, disrupting critical services, and imposing substantial financial burdens. Government was a prime target of ransomware attacks throughout 2023 and into 2024, seeing a 48% increase year-over-year in the number of attacks according to data from the Zscaler ThreatLabz 2024 Ransomware Report.
Understanding the intricate workings of these cyber threats is crucial for developing effective defense mechanisms. This webinar, "Fortifying State and Local Defenses: Navigating the Four Stages of Ransomware Attacks," will walk attendees through the four stages of a ransomware attack and review aligning response strategies to attack techniques.
